What Exactly Are Downed Power Lines?
Downed power lines happen when a utility pole gets knocked over, a wire snaps, or a storm rips through the grid. Suddenly, live electricity is dangling from the sky, swaying in the wind. These lines aren’t just a nuisance—they’re a deadly hazard. Even if they look harmless, they can electrocute anyone who touches them, including drivers, pedestrians, or animals.

What Should You Do Instead?
If you encounter downed power lines, here’s the game plan:
- Stop immediately. Don’t panic, but don’t move.
- Call 911. Report the location and stay put.
- Warn others. If you’re with passengers, tell them to stay in the car. If you’re on foot, back away slowly.
- Wait for help. Power crews will shut off the electricity before anyone gets hurt.
